Compare USPS Domestic Mail & Shipping ServicesSmall letters include enveloped mail, lettersheets and unenclosed postcards. A small letter is: • no larger than 130mm x 240mm • no thicker than 5mm • no heavier than 250g. To avoid small letters being trapped in machinery or other letters, small letters should exceed 88mm x 138mm. Sealing of envelope mail is preferred.

If the medium manila weighs between 2.1oz and 3.0oz, 2 additional ounce …What is a Large Envelope? The amount of postage required for any envelope depends on its size, weight, and destination. The United States Postal Service (USPS) classifies larger envelopes as “flats,” which include envelopes that are more than 6 1/8 inches high or 11 1/2 inches long or 1/4 inch thick..
